Transaction 843246c28e1a0df873e2b0653df65226c8aef78bafc4e6d23746e50284c48f37

1 Input
2 Outputs
  • 843246c28e1a0df873e2b0653df65226c8aef78bafc4e6d23746e50284c48f37:0
  • value  1487290339
    address  3Dkmuqg8FTy5eYfMbVUYRD58rsrYZijnCM
  • 843246c28e1a0df873e2b0653df65226c8aef78bafc4e6d23746e50284c48f37:1
  • value  26256589
    address  1AcDBhECPUDXWPA8xWKJ9F2NME5VupURJD